What to know

Dealership equipment financing is the cleanest fit when the asset has a useful life and a resale value. In 2026, the usual play is simple: finance the machine, match the term to the asset life, and keep working capital available for parts, payroll, and reconditioning. That is auto dealership asset finance in practice, and it is different from a pure working-capital draw, which is better for short gaps and urgent expenses, and different again from an SBA file, which gives you longer amortization but asks for more time, more documentation, and a slower close.

The practical cutoff is usually the file, not the sign on the building. Through our funding partner, equipment financing can go from a $10K ticket to $5M, with a 580 credit floor, 6 months in business, and $100K+/year revenue. If you are trying to get to zero down, the partner floor is 650+ credit. That matters because a dealer with a strong asset and a clean revenue line may get a better structure on a lift package than on an unsecured draw, even if both are used in the same month. That is why equipment financing for auto dealers and dealership equipment financing can look similar on paper but price differently once a lender sees the asset, the revenue, and the time in business.

That is also why the wrong product can cost you more than the rate sheet suggests. A working-capital advance may fund fast, but at a factor rate of 1.15-1.40 it should be reserved for short-cycle needs, not a five-year asset. A business term loan can be a good middle ground for an equipment package under $100K, but the file still needs at least 600 credit, 12 months in business, and $100K+/year revenue. If you are comparing terms across stores in Baton Rouge and New Orleans, the right question is not just what the ZIP code is; it is whether the deal is secured by equipment, by cash flow, or by both.

For tax planning in 2026, qualifying financed equipment can still be eligible for Section 179 expensing, and the limit is $1,220,000. That does not change the financing decision, but it can change how a dealer thinks about timing a lift purchase, a scan-tool refresh, or a showroom refresh. Frequently asked questions

What financing fits a dealership lift, diagnostic scanner, or showroom upgrade?

Equipment financing is usually the cleanest fit. As of July 2026 through our funding partner, it can cover $10K-$5M, with 8%-25% APR, 3-7 day funding, and zero down available at 650+ credit.

How fast can a Shreveport dealer get money if the need is urgent?

Working capital can fund as fast as 24 hours, but it is meant for short-term gaps, not long-life assets. If you need the machine itself, equipment financing is the better match.

When should a dealer use SBA instead of equipment financing?

Use SBA when the project is larger, slower, and meant to stretch payments over years. As of 2026, SBA 7(a) can run $50K-$5M+ with 10-25 year terms, but it usually takes 30-90 days to close.
